Abstract EN
We consider families of general four-point quadrature formulae using a generalization of the Montgomery identity via Taylor’s formula.
The results are applied to obtain some sharp inequalities for functions whose derivatives belong to Lp spaces.
Generalizations of Simpson’s 3/8 formula and the Lobatto four-point formula with related inequalities are considered as special cases.
